Purpose of the role:
High-Level Position Purpose: The Supply Chain Development Analyst is part of Maersk's Global Supply Chain Development function within Maersk Sales. The role reports into the leader of Supply Chain Development within the Global Service Centre of Maersk. The role contributes to logistics solution sales for Maersk customers, based on identifying and quantifying opportunities and tailoring value propositions for Maersk's priority customers.
The role will provide a fantastic opportunity to work on cutting edge areas of logistics and supply chain management services across multiple industries. The role is a stepping stone to build a long and successful career in logistics, especially within the global organization of Maersk. In addition to growth opportunities within the team, the mentorship, trainings and on-the-ground learnings will motivate and inspire candidates towards becoming an expert on supply chains.
The role will involve working closely with regional teams of Supply Chain Development (SCD) to identify and sell Maersk value propositions to customers. The regional Supply Chain Development team members (across different regions of the world) will be directly working on specific customer opportunities, working with account managers for the respective customers to identify, qualify and pitch compelling value propositions to new and existing logistics customers. The Supply Chain Development Analysts will also be following the lead of the Regional Manager in the assigned opportunities to drive high impact customer engagement, thought leadership and in depth understanding of logistics industry and Maersk services. The supply chain development Analyst and regional managers will be involved in creating customized and innovative supply chain solutions for Maersk's customers. While the Supply Chain Development Analyst role will likely remotely engaged with the customer and internal stakeholders, there will be customer facing opportunities for the Supply Chain Development Analyst role. The role will also contribute to the continued improvement and innovation in the Supply Chain Development team and the larger commercial organization and thereby be recognized globally for in depth knowledge and problem solving on supply chain topics, including proficient execution of analysis and modelling task.
You will be responsible for:
- Supporting Supply Chain Development team on identifying opportunities with customers and selling compelling Maersk logistics solutions – the Supply Chain Development Analyst will be assigned to specific opportunities where she/he will work with a Maersk multi-functional sales pursuit team
- Executing analyses and modelling tasks as needed to aid the sales opportunity
- Focusing on quantifiable value and other implications for customer and Maersk wherever possible
- Preparing reports of findings, illustrating data graphically and translating complex findings into written text with critical thinking skills
- Managing own tasks in the pursuit team to the highest quality within the assigned deadline
- Displaying ownership of the pursuit, with ability to manage and communicate to stakeholders towards the success of the sales pursuit
- Possessing and continue learning of supply chain industry and Maersk's offerings
- Driving and contributing to innovation, standardization and capability-building areas in the Supply Chain Development team
- Displaying role model behaviour on ownership, motivation and teamwork
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Business Administration, Mathematics, Statistics, Economics, Science or any other similar discipline
- Relevant customer facing experience of 2 - 4 years in supply chain consulting is mandatory
Must Have Skills:
Education/Knowledge/Experience in Logistics
Experience working with Supply chain analysis software like Llamasoft Supply Chain Guru, Siemens Supply Chain Suite, etc
Strong quantitative, research, and data analytics skills contributing towards problem solving
Skillful at manipulating, analysing and interpreting large datasets via data science techniques
- Working knowledge of MS Office (Word, PowerPoint and Excel)
Knowledge of R/Python/MS Power BI
Strong communication and presentation skills to elicit the implications of the assigned tasks for the customer and Maersk
Fluent in English, oral and written
Flexibility to work in EU Shifts
